What Is Negligence Law?
Negligence claims involve injuries caused by a failure to use reasonable care. People are expected to act reasonably with other people. If they fail to act as a reasonable person and cause an accident, they are liable for damages. There are four elements to prove negligence:
- The person causing injury owed a duty of care to others
- They breached that duty of care by failing to act as a reasonable person
- Their actions caused an accident
- Someone suffered harm as a result
In a personal injury accident, the injury victim can file a lawsuit against the person who negligently caused the accident. If the injury victim proves negligence, the person who caused the accident must pay compensation, including medical bills and lost wages.
What Are Some Examples of Situations Where I Might Need a Personal Injury Lawyer To Sue for Negligence?
A personal injury lawyer can help you recover compensation for injuries caused by negligence. There are many examples of negligence claims for injury accidents, including:
- Car accidents
- Motorcycle accidents
- Slip and falls
- Truck accidents
- Workplace injuries
- Medical malpractice
There is a limited time to file a personal injury lawsuit for negligence. The statute of limitations only gives you a limited time to file a claim. A personal injury lawyer understands the time limits and will make sure you file your negligence claim in time.

What Could Happen if I Don’t Hire a Personal Injury Lawyer?
If you don’t hire a personal injury lawyer, you might struggle to get fair compensation for your injuries. Without legal guidance, you could miss important deadlines to file a lawsuit, fail to gather the right evidence, or be taken advantage of by insurance companies. This might result in accepting a settlement offer that is less than what you need to cover medical bills, lost wages, and other expenses. A lawyer helps protect your rights, builds a strong case, and negotiates on your behalf, increasing your chances of getting the most possible compensation.
What Are the Top Questions When Choosing a Personal Injury Lawyer in Camden?
These questions can help you decide if you feel comfortable that a lawyer has the experience and ability to manage your case well. Most personal injury lawyers offer free consultations that allow you to understand your options and get specific legal advice before hiring them. The top questions to ask include:
- What experience do you have in handling personal injury cases?
- Have you previously represented clients with similar types of accidents or injuries to mine?
- How long have you been practicing in New Jersey?
- What is your success rate in winning settlements or verdicts for your clients in personal injury cases?
- How will you assess the strength of my case and determine its value?
- Do you have a network of experts, such as accident reconstruction specialists or medical professionals, who can support my case if needed? What is your approach to negotiating with insurance companies?
- What percentage of my compensation will you take in fees?
